What Is a Legal Video Deposition?
A legal video deposition is a taped testimony given by a witness under oath, generally conducted outside of the courtroom. This procedure allows attorneys to collect info and assess the integrity of witnesses prior to a trial. Video depositions offer several purposes, consisting of maintaining the witness's represent future recommendation and supplying an aesthetic depiction of their attitude and expression. This can be particularly beneficial in instances where the witness may be incapable to show up in court as a result of health concerns or other dedications. The environment of a video deposition is typically much less formal than that of a court room, which can aid witnesses feel much more secure while providing their testament. The resulting video can be used during the test to sustain or test insurance claims made by either event. On the whole, lawful video depositions are a vital device in the exploration process, enhancing the total effectiveness of legal procedures.
Key Parts of Video Clip Depositions
Video clip depositions contain numerous crucial components that add to their performance in lawful process. High-quality audio-visual devices is essential to capture clear noise and photo, guaranteeing that the statement is both obtainable and dependable. Second, an expert videographer plays a substantial role, handling the technological facets while preserving a neutral existence throughout the deposition.Another important element is the physical setting, which have to be conducive to a formal interview, typically appearing like a courtroom environment. This includes suitable illumination, seating setups, and history settings to decrease distractions.Additionally, the presence of a court press reporter is important, as they give a verbatim records of the proceedings, confirming a full record. The appropriate handling and storage space of the video data, along with adherence to legal protocols, shield the honesty of the deposition for future referral. These parts collectively guarantee the deposition's integrity as evidence in court.


Benefits of Utilizing Video Depositions
Using video clip depositions offers many benefits that enhance the lawful procedure. They provide an even more precise representation of witness testimony, recording not just words yet also non-verbal signs such as body language and tone. This added measurement can substantially affect a jury's assumption during trial. In addition, video depositions can boost access, enabling lawyers to share testimony conveniently with colleagues and customers who may be unable to go to in person.Furthermore, video clip recordings work as a powerful device for impeachment, as they can highlight incongruities or discrepancies in witness statements. They likewise promote much better preparation for test by permitting lawful teams to evaluate the deposition carefully. Video depositions can reduce the requirement for in-person looks, conserving time and resources for all events involved. On the whole, the incorporation of video clip right into depositions stands for a useful advancement in legal process

Ideal Practices for Performing Video Clip Depositions
Conducting efficient video clip depositions needs cautious planning and attention to information. Attorneys need to validate that all technological equipment is evaluated in development, consisting of video cameras, microphones, and lights, to stay clear of disturbances throughout the session. A well-lit and peaceful atmosphere is necessary to record clear audio and video clip, lessening interruptions that might impact the deposition's integrity.It is crucial to prepare all participants regarding the process, consisting of standards on talking plainly and resolving the video camera. This helps in developing here a much more appealing and expert atmosphere. Furthermore, having a back-up recording approach is a good idea to stop information loss.Legal agents ought to also acquaint themselves with the details policies regulating video depositions in their jurisdiction, guaranteeing conformity throughout the process. Finally, detailed testimonial and modifying of the last recording might be essential to guarantee it fulfills legal requirements and supplies a clear representation of the testament provided.
When to Consider Video Clip Depositions in Your Situation
When should attorneys think about making use of video depositions in their instances? Video depositions are particularly beneficial in circumstances where witness trustworthiness may be necessary, such as high-stakes litigation or situations involving intricate testimonies. They permit juries and courts to evaluate a witness's disposition and body movement, which can greatly affect their assumption of the statement's reliability.Additionally, video depositions serve when a witness is not able to participate in the trial because of wellness issues, geographical restrictions, or absence. Capturing their statement on video clip guarantees that their statements are protected in an engaging format.Moreover, in instances involving professional witnesses, video clip depositions can give an appealing discussion of complex information, enhancing the jury's understanding. Lastly, attorneys might choose video depositions to develop an extra impactful story during trial, enabling a much more brilliant representation of the proof presented.
